### prompt
@index.ts 에다가 mcp tool 추가해줘.
도구 이름은 greeting으로 하고 유저에게 이름과 언어를 입력받아서 해당 언어로 인사말을 반환해주는 도구야
calc라고 하는 도구를 추가할거야.
두개의 숫자와 하나의 연산자를 입력받아서 계산후 결과를 반환해주는 도구를 추가해줘
유저에게 timezone을 입력받아서 현재 시간을 반환하는 도구를 추가해줘
해당 mcp server에 리소스 추가해줘
단순하게 현재 가짜 서버 정보를 반환하게 해줘
mcp server prompt 추가해줘
code_review라는 이름으로 추가할거고, 유저에게 코드를 받아서 코드 리뷰할 수 있는 프롬프트를 추가해줘
이미지 생성 MCP Tool 추가해
- 입력 Parameter (단일): prompt
- 도구 호출 결과: base64-encoded-data image 형식
~~~
ai-mcp-server-test라는 이름으로 Github Repository 생성하고 main 브랜치에 push해
현재 MCP 서버를 smithery에 배포하려 하는데 요구사항 세팅해줘:
# TypeScript Servers
~~~~
### terminal
terminal
> npm install
> npx tsc
: ts file -> js file complie
# 여기서 js file을 업데이트 했으면 cursor settings로 가서 해당 mcp server를 껏다가 켜야함
> npx @modelcontextprotocol/inspector node build/index.js
: 서버 실행
> npm install
: hugging face install
> npx tsc
: js code 컴파일
# index.ts에서 fal-ai를 auto로 변경 -> hugging face 사용 가능
> gh auth login
> gh auth status
> git init
> npm install
> npm run dev
: 로컬에서 배포시 상황 가정 (in smithery)
### 기타
fal-ai => auto